Water Heater

Water Heater Repair and Installation

Water heater repair and installation probably makes up 30% of our heating work. When your water heater dies, you notice immediately - no hot showers, no hot water for dishes, no hot water for laundry. Most water heaters last 8-12 years before they need replacement.

​

Signs your water heater is failing:

  • Not enough hot water or water isn't hot enough

  • Rust-colored hot water

  • Rumbling or popping sounds

  • Water pooling around the base

  • Age - if its over 10 years old, its on borrowed time

 

We repair water heaters when its worth fixing. A bad heating element on an electric water heater? That's a $200 repair on a $500 unit - makes sense to fix it. A leaking tank on a 12-year-old water heater? That needs replacement because the tank can't be repaired.

 

Water heater installation takes 3-4 hours for a standard tank replacement. We disconnect the old one, drain it, remove it, install the new one, connect gas or electric, fill it, test it, and clean up. Same day service in most cases. We install gas water heaters and electric water heaters, whatever matches your existing setup.

​

Tank size matters. A 40-gallon tank works for 1-2 people. A 50-gallon tank is better for 3-4 people. Larger families need 75-80 gallon tanks. We'll size your new water heater based on your household needs, not just replace it with the same size you had.

Tankless Water Heater

Tankless Water Heater Installation

Tankless water heater installation has gotten really popular in Yonkers over the past 5 years. Tankless units heat water on demand instead of keeping 40-50 gallons hot all the time. They save energy, never run out of hot water, and last 20+ years instead of 10-12.

​

Benefits of tankless water heaters:

  • Never run out of hot water during long showers

  • Lower energy bills (20-30% savings)

  • Takes up way less space than tank heaters

  • Lasts twice as long as traditional tanks

  • Can supply multiple fixtures at once

 

The downsides? They cost more upfront - about double the price of a tank heater including installation. They need annual maintenance to prevent mineral buildup. And older homes sometimes need electrical or gas line upgrades to support them.

 

We install both gas and electric tankless water heaters. Gas tankless is more powerful and works better for larger homes. Electric tankless works great for smaller homes or as point-of-use heaters for distant bathrooms that take forever to get hot water.

​

Installation takes longer than tank heaters - usually a full day because we need to run new venting for gas units or upgrade electrical for electric units. But once its installed, you'll have endless hot water and lower energy bills for the next 20 years.

Boiler Repair and Installation

Boiler repair and installation is our specialty. Yonkers has more boiler-heated homes than almost anywhere - steam boilers and hot water boilers in houses built from 1890 through the present. We work on them all.

 

Common boiler problems we fix:

  • Boiler won't fire up or start

  • Not enough heat in some rooms

  • Boiler cycling on and off constantly

  • Leaking water from boiler or pipes

  • Banging, knocking, or kettling sounds

  • Pressure too high or too low

  • Pilot light won't stay lit

 

Most boiler repairs are fairly straightforward for experienced heating contractors. Bad circulator pump? We replace it in an hour. Faulty pressure relief valve? 30 minutes. Thermostat not calling for heat? Quick diagnosis and fix. We carry parts for most boiler brands on our trucks.

​

Boiler installation is needed when your boiler is beyond repair - cracked heat exchanger, failed boiler sections, or its just too old and inefficient to keep running. Modern high-efficiency boilers use 30-40% less fuel than old boilers. The savings on your heating bill can pay for the new boiler over time.

​

We install steam boilers and hot water boilers. We handle radiator systems, baseboard systems, radiant floor systems. We size the boiler correctly for your house - too small and you don't get enough heat, too big and the boiler short-cycles and wastes fuel.

​

Boiler installation usually takes 2-3 days depending on the complexity. We remove the old boiler, install the new one, connect all the zones, test everything, balance the system, and make sure every room heats properly. We pull permits and schedule inspections so everything's done legal and safe.

Furnace Cleaning and Repair

Furnace cleaning and repair keeps forced-air heating systems running efficiently. Furnaces are common in newer Yonkers homes and in houses that were converted from boilers to forced air. They use gas or oil to heat air, then blow that air through ducts to every room.

​

Furnaces need annual cleaning and maintenance. Dirty burners waste fuel. Dirty filters restrict airflow and make the furnace work harder. Dirty blower motors fail prematurely. We clean furnaces thoroughly - burners, heat exchanger, blower assembly, controls, everything.

​

Common furnace repairs:

  • Igniter that won't light the burners

  • Blower motor that won't run or makes noise

  • Limit switch that keeps shutting system down

  • Cracked heat exchanger (this is serious)

  • Thermostat problems

  • Ductwork leaks losing heat

 

Cracked heat exchangers are the worst furnace problem because they let combustion gases mix with the air going into your house. This means carbon monoxide in your breathing air. If we find a cracked heat exchanger, the furnace needs replacement - there's no safe repair.

 

We repair furnaces when it makes financial sense. A $300 igniter replacement on a 5-year-old furnace? Absolutely worth it. A $600 blower motor on a 20-year-old furnace with other issues? Probably time to replace the whole unit instead of throwing good money after bad.

Heating System Inspection and Maintenance

Heating system inspection and maintenance prevents most emergency breakdowns. We inspect and tune up boilers, furnaces, and water heaters before winter starts. This catches small problems before they become big problems that leave you without heat at 2am.

​

What we do during heating system maintenance:

  • Clean burners and combustion chamber

  • Test all safety controls

  • Check and adjust pressure/temperature

  • Lubricate moving parts

  • Test for gas leaks and carbon monoxide

  • Inspect venting and exhaust

  • Check electrical connections

  • Test thermostat operation

  • Measure efficiency

 

Annual maintenance extends the life of your heating system. A well-maintained boiler lasts 25-30 years. A neglected boiler might only last 15 years. Same with furnaces - maintenance matters.

Why Heating Systems Fail in Yonkers?

Yonkers heating systems work hard. Seven months of heating every year, temperature swings from single digits to 50 degrees, and constant cycling on and off. The stress adds up.

​

Old age is the number one reason. The original boiler from 1960 isn't gonna last forever. Water heaters corrode. Furnace heat exchangers crack. Components wear out. By the time a heating system is 20-25 years old, repairs become more frequent and more expensive.

​

Poor maintenance accelerates failure. Dirty burners waste fuel and damage components. Low water in boilers causes overheating. Dirty filters make furnaces overheat. These problems are 100% preventable with basic annual maintenance, but most people don't think about their heating system until it stops working.

​

Yonkers water is fairly hard, which means mineral buildup in boilers and water heaters. This reduces efficiency and causes premature failure. Flushing your boiler and water heater regularly removes these minerals before they cause damage.

​

The hills in Yonkers also affect heating. Houses at the bottom of hills sometimes have water infiltration issues that damage heating systems in basements. Houses at the top of hills get more wind exposure that stresses heating systems. Every neighborhood has its own patterns of heating problems.

How to Prevent Heating Emergencies?

Most heating emergencies are preventable with proper maintenance and attention to warning signs. Here's what to watch for:

​

Get annual maintenance done every fall. This catches problems early. Strange noises from your heating system? Don't ignore them - weird sounds mean something's wrong. Not enough heat in some rooms? Your system needs attention. Higher heating bills with no change in usage? Efficiency is dropping.

​

Know where your emergency shutoffs are - gas shutoff, water supply to boiler, electrical disconnect. If you smell gas, shut off the gas and call the gas company immediately, then call us. If your carbon monoxide detector goes off, get everyone out of the house first, then call for help.

​

Keep vents and radiators clear. Don't store stuff on top of or in front of heating equipment. Change furnace filters monthly during heating season. If you have a boiler, check the pressure gauge occasionally - it should be around 12-15 PSI for most systems.
